When set to false, + moved lines are not colored. + color.diff.:: Use customized color for diff colorization. `` specifies which part of the patch to use the specified color, and is one of `context` (context text - `plain` is a historical synonym), `meta` (metainformation), `frag` (hunk header), 'func' (function in hunk header), `old` (removed lines), - `new` (added lines), `commit` (commit headers), or `whitespace` - (highlighting whitespace errors). + `new` (added lines), `commit` (commit headers), `whitespace` + (highlighting whitespace errors), `oldMoved` (deleted lines), + `newMoved` (added lines), `oldMovedDimmed`, `oldMovedAlternative`, + `oldMovedAlternativeDimmed`, `newMovedDimmed`, `newMovedAlternative` + and `newMovedAlternativeDimmed` (See the '' + setting of '--color-moved' in linkgit:git-diff[1] for details). color.decorate.:: Use customized color for 'git log --decorate' output. `` is one diff --git a/Documentation/diff-options.txt b/Documentation/diff-options.txt index 89cc0f48de..bc52bd0b99 100644 --- a/Documentation/diff-options.txt +++ b/Documentation/diff-options.txt @@ -231,6 +231,42 @@ ifdef::git-diff[] endif::git-diff[] It is the same as `--color=never`. +--color-moved[=]:: + Moved lines of code are colored differently. +ifdef::git-diff[] + It can be changed by the `diff.colorMoved` configuration setting. +endif::git-diff[] + The defaults to 'no' if the option is not given + and to 'zebra' if the option with no mode is given. + The mode must be one of: ++ +-- +no:: + Moved lines are not highlighted. +default:: + Is a synonym for `zebra`. This may change to a more sensible mode + in the future. +plain:: + Any line that is added in one location and was removed + in another location will be colored with 'color.diff.newMoved'. + Similarly 'color.diff.oldMoved' will be used for removed lines + that are added somewhere else in the diff. This mode picks up any + moved line, but it is not very useful in a review to determine + if a block of code was moved without permutation. +zebra:: + Blocks of moved code are detected greedily. The detected blocks are + painted using either the 'color.diff.{old,new}Moved' color or + 'color.diff.{old,new}MovedAlternative'. The change between + the two colors indicates that a new block was detected. If there + are fewer than 3 adjacent moved lines, they are not marked up + as moved, but the regular colors 'color.diff.{old,new}' will be + used. +dimmed_zebra:: + Similar to 'zebra', but additional dimming of uninteresting parts + of moved code is performed. The bordering lines of two adjacent + blocks are considered interesting, the rest is uninteresting. +-- + --word-diff[=]:: Show a word diff, using the to delimit changed words.
